Q: Is 55,275,515 a Prime Number?
A: No, 55,275,515 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 55275515 can be evenly divided by 1 5 1,091 5,455 10,133 50,665 11,055,103 and 55,275,515, with no remainder.
Since 55,275,515 cannot be divided by just 1 and 55,275,515, it is not a prime number.
